هل الفهارس العنقودية مجزأة؟

هل الفهارس العنقودية مجزأة؟
هل الفهارس العنقودية مجزأة؟
Anonim

لا تعتقد أنه نظرًا لأنك تتجنب استخدام GUIDs كمفاتيح مجموعة وتجنب تحديث أعمدة متغيرة الطول في جداولك ، فإن فهارسك المجمعةستكون محصنة ضد التجزئة. … عليك فقط أن تدرك أنها يمكن أن تسبب التجزئة وتعرف كيفية اكتشافها وإزالتها والتخفيف من حدتها.

هل يمكن تجزئة الفهرس العنقودي؟

بعد إدخال 2000 صف يكون التجزئة عند حوالي4٪. … ومع ذلك ، سيتم تحديث كل سجل 3 مرات على الأقل بعد ذلك. ينتج عن هذا تجزئة لهذا الفهرس العنقودي بأكثر من 99٪ (مع عامل التعبئة الافتراضي)..

كيف يتم تجزئة الفهارس؟

في فهارس B-tree (rowstore) ، يوجد التجزئةعندما تحتوي الفهارس على صفحات لا يتطابق فيها الترتيب المنطقي داخل الفهرس ، استنادًا إلى القيم الأساسية للفهرس ، مع الترتيب المادي لـ فهرس الصفحات.

ما هي الميزة الرئيسية للفهرسة العنقودية؟

يعد الفهرس العنقوديمفيدًا لاستعلامات النطاق لأن البيانات يتم فرزها منطقيًا على المفتاح. يمكنك نقل جدول إلى مجموعة ملفات أخرى عن طريق إعادة إنشاء فهرس متفاوت في مجموعة ملفات مختلفة. لا يتعين عليك إسقاط الجدول كما تفعل عند تحريك كومة. مفتاح التجميع هو جزء من كافة الفهارس غير العنقودية.

كيف يتم تخزين الفهارس المجمعة؟

يتم تخزين الفهارس العنقوديةكأشجار. باستخدام الفهرس العنقودي ، يتم تخزين البيانات الفعلية في العقد الطرفية. هذا يمكن أن يسرع الحصول علىالبيانات عند إجراء بحث في الفهرس. نتيجة لذلك ، مطلوب عدد أقل من عمليات الإدخال / الإخراج.

موصى به: